AFP CEO conveys his condolences to Al Jazeera teams after the death of journalist Shireen Abu Akleh

Fabrice Fries, Chairman and CEO at AFP, has conveyed his condolences to Sheikh Hamad bin Thamer Al-Thani, Chairman of the Board for Al Jazeera media network, after the death of journalist Shireen Abu Akleh.

AFP awarded at Bayeux-Calvados War Correspondents Prize

The 25th Bayeux-Calvados War Correspondents Prize event singled out two AFP photojournalists. Mahmud Hams received the first prize in the Photo category while Juan Barreto is awarded with the third prize.

"The survivors forgotten by justice" wins the 2022 Breach-Valdez Prize

May 12, Mexico City - A report about women who survived attempted femicide has won the Breach-Valdez Prize, which honours human rights and freedom of the press.
